What can I see and do near Mangga Dua Square?
Study the collections at Jakarta History Museum, National Museum of Indonesia or Balai Seni Rupa. Pasar Baru, Merdeka Palace and Museum of Fine Arts and Ceramics are notable landmarks to explore if you're in the area. You can enjoy live performances at Ismail Marzuki Park and Aula Simfonia Jakarta.
How can I get to Mangga Dua Square?
If you want to see more of the area, jump aboard a train from Jakarta Kampung Bandan Station, Jakarta Kota Station or Jakarta Jayakarta Station. There might not be many public transport stops near Mangga Dua Square so consider a car rental to maximise your time.
